specific Embodiment approach 1
[0014] Embodiment 1: In this embodiment, the bamboo charcoal-based electromagnetic shielding composite material consists of 20-90 parts by mass of polymer resin, 10-50 parts of bamboo charcoal powder, 4-7 parts of metal particle additives, 0-10 parts of It is made of magnetically permeable medium and 0.2-0.3 parts of coupling agent.
specific Embodiment approach 2
[0015] Embodiment 2: The difference between this embodiment and Embodiment 1 is that the bamboo charcoal-based electromagnetic shielding composite material consists of 40 to 70 parts of polymer resin, 20 to 40 parts of bamboo charcoal powder, and 5 to 6 parts of metal in parts by mass. It is made of particle additives, 2-8 parts of magnetically permeable medium and 0.2-0.3 parts of coupling agent. Others are the same as in the first embodiment.
specific Embodiment approach 3
[0016] Embodiment three: the difference between this embodiment and embodiment one is that the bamboo charcoal-based electromagnetic shielding composite material consists of 60 parts by mass of polymer resin, 30 parts of bamboo charcoal powder, 5 parts of metal particle additives, 6 parts of Made of magnetically permeable medium and 0.3 parts of coupling agent. Others are the same as in the first embodiment.
